8.4
116 Stanton St (btwn Essex & Ludlow St.), New York, NY
Greek Restaurant · Lower East Side · 198 tips and reviews
695 10th Ave (btwn W 47th & W 48th St), New York, NY
Taco Restaurant · Hell's Kitchen · 123 tips and reviews
Foursquare © 2025 Lovingly made in NYC, CHI, SEA & LA